Mastering Gold and Silver Markets: Insights from a Legendary Bullion Bank Trader


Overview

Explore the high-stakes world of gold and silver trading In Mastering Gold and Silver Markets: Insights from a Legendary Bullion Bank Trader, veteran precious metals trader, Robert Gottlieb, delivers an insightful blend of memoir and education that covers the world of bullion trading from a banker’s perspective. The book covers his journey from working at a certified public accounting firm to his position as the Global Head of Precious Metals Trading and Sales at many of the largest bullion banks in the world. Gottlieb dives deep into the critical role played by bullion banks in the global precious metals ecosystem. He provides a detailed explanation of financial and futures markets and how they facilitate liquidity and hedging strategies for their clients. You’ll also learn about how banks leverage arbitrage opportunities between the CME futures markets and the London OTC markets to meet customer needs. You’ll find: Explanations of the supply-and-demand fundamentals of gold and silver An engaging combination of personal experience, industry expertise, and thought-provoking analysis Examinations of significant disruptions to gold and silver markets, including Covid-19 and the impacts of US tariff announcements in 2025 Perfect for mining company executives, central bankers, Wall Stret traders, and professionals in finance and commodities trading, Mastering Gold and Silver Markets is also a must-read for hedge fund managers, wealth portfolio managers, and retail investors.

Author Information

ROBERT GOTTLIEB is a legendary precious metals trader with more than four decades’ experience at major financial institutions. His career includes leadership roles as Managing Director of Precious Metals Trading and Sales at Citibank, HSBC, Bear Stearns, JP Morgan, and Koch Supply & Trading. He managed one of the world’s largest CME/London arbitrage books, provided technical gold expertise to the World Gold Council during the launch of the GLD ETF, and has been quoted by Bloomberg, Reuters, The Wall Street Journal, Financial Times, and The Washington Post.
